powerdesigner 创建项目
时间: 2023-12-12 19:01:22 浏览: 85
PowerDesigner 是一个强大的建模工具,用于创建和管理数据库、数据仓库和业务流程模型。要在 PowerDesigner 中创建项目,首先需要打开该软件并选择“新建项目”选项。然后,需要输入项目的名称和保存路径,并选择所需的模型类型(如数据库模型、数据仓库模型、业务流程模型等)。接下来,可以选择创建空白项目或者基于现有的模板进行项目创建。
在创建项目后,可以开始向项目中添加各种模型对象,比如数据库表、列、关系、数据仓库维度、事实表、业务流程图等。可以选择适当的工具和功能来设计模型,并且可以进行模型间的关联和继承。此外,PowerDesigner 还提供了丰富的文档生成功能,可以根据创建的模型自动生成相应的文档,方便项目管理和团队协作。
在项目创建和设计过程中,可以使用 PowerDesigner 的版本控制功能来管理项目的不同版本,确保团队成员之间的协作和沟通。同时,PowerDesigner 还支持与其他建模工具和数据库管理系统的集成,方便项目的进一步开发和部署。
总之,通过 PowerDesigner 创建项目,可以帮助用户快速、高效地进行数据库、数据仓库和业务流程的建模和设计,提高项目的质量和管理效率。
相关问题
powerdesigner怎么创建实体
PowerDesigner是一款强大的数据库设计工具,用于建立数据模型,包括实体(Entity)。以下是创建实体的基本步骤:
1. **打开 PowerDesigner**:首先,启动PowerDesigner并选择新建项目。
2. **添加数据源**:如果你已经有了数据库连接,点击“Data”选项卡,然后选择“Add Data Source”,输入数据库的相关信息,如服务器、数据库名称等。
3. **导航到实体模版**:在左侧的工具栏中,通常会看到“ERWin”或者“Modeler”的图标,点击进入模型视图。
4. **右键点击并选择“New Entity”**:在空白处或者已有的表或视图上右键,选择“New Entity”,系统会弹出创建新实体的对话框。
5. **填写实体属性**:在新的窗口中,输入实体的名称,并在属性区域为实体添加字段(Columns),每个字段都有相应的名称、数据类型和可能的约束条件。
6. **关联其他实体**:如果需要,可以在“Relationships”标签页下添加实体之间的关系(如一对一、一对多或多对多),通过设置外键链接两个实体。
7. **保存实体**:完成后,记得保存你的实体。可以将其导出为DDL脚本用于数据库创建,或者直接在PowerDesigner中生成ERD图。
如何使用PowerDesigner创建顶层数据流图(DFD)并进行活动细化?
要使用PowerDesigner创建顶层数据流图(DFD)并进行活动细化,首先需要了解DFD的基本组成部分和创建流程。DFD主要由四部分组成:数据流、数据存储、处理过程以及外部实体。使用PowerDesigner时,可以按照以下步骤进行操作:
参考资源链接:[PowerDesigner DFD绘制指南:从顶层到细节操作详解](https://wenku.csdn.net/doc/5npc3yhuy9?spm=1055.2569.3001.10343)
首先,打开PowerDesigner软件,选择新建项目并创建一个数据流图。在数据流图中,你可以使用矩形来表示外部实体(即与系统交互的外部系统或用户)以及处理过程(即系统中的业务活动)。
然后,使用箭头表示数据流,它们展示数据在各个处理过程和外部实体之间的流向。数据存储则用两条平行线表示,可以用来标注系统中的数据存储位置。
对于顶层DFD,通常关注的是系统的高阶功能和主要数据流。你可以通过在处理过程中添加加号(+)来标识可以进一步细化的子活动或处理过程,从而实现活动的细化。
在细化的过程中,你需要详细描述每个子活动的输入和输出数据,确保每个步骤的业务逻辑清晰明了。细化可以一直进行到具体的业务流程级别,使得整个数据流图能够详细反映系统的业务流程。
此外,PowerDesigner支持数据字典的生成,你可以通过在DFD中为每个数据流和数据存储添加注释,软件将帮助你自动生成数据字典。数据字典是理解和实现数据流图的关键,它详细记录了数据元素的定义和属性。
为了更深入地理解如何使用PowerDesigner绘制DFD并进行活动细化,可以参考《PowerDesigner DFD绘制指南:从顶层到细节操作详解》。这本指南详细介绍了PowerDesigner中DFD绘制的规则、常用符号以及操作技巧,通过阅读这份资料,你将能够更加熟练地操作软件,绘制出符合业务需求的DFD。
参考资源链接:[PowerDesigner DFD绘制指南:从顶层到细节操作详解](https://wenku.csdn.net/doc/5npc3yhuy9?spm=1055.2569.3001.10343)
阅读全文